Technology speeds: 56,000 Kbps maximum downstream data, controllerless
NOTE: 56 Kbps technology refers to download speeds only and requires
compatible modems at server sites. Other conditions may limit modem speed.
FCC limitations allow a maximum of 53 Kbps during download transmissions.

PCI Bus Power Management Interface Specification (PCI-PM) Revision 1.2,
Appendix A. D0, D3hot, and D3cold. Wake on Ring state when in D3cold. If the
power management event (PME) feature is enabled in D3cold, a modem can
wake the system via WAKE# (WAKEN) or beacon. Meets PCI Express 1.1
standard.
